WPSSDK工具包有哪些功能和使用优势?

WPSSDK工具包

{ "doc_id": "12345", "user_token": "abcdefg" }

WPSSDK工具包有哪些功能?

WPSSDK工具包是一款专为WPS Office生态设计的开发工具集合,它为开发者提供了丰富的功能接口,帮助快速集成WPS的核心能力到第三方应用中。以下是其主要功能的详细介绍,适合零基础开发者逐步理解:

1. 文档操作功能
WPSSDK支持对WPS文档(如Word、Excel、PPT)进行基础操作,包括创建、打开、保存、关闭文件。开发者可以通过API实现批量处理文档,例如自动生成合同模板或批量修改报表数据。例如,调用WPS.Document.open()接口即可在应用中直接打开指定路径的文档,无需手动跳转。

2. 格式编辑与样式控制
工具包提供了精细的格式编辑接口,可修改字体、字号、颜色、段落对齐等样式。对于Excel文件,还能控制单元格格式(如数字类型、边框样式)。典型场景是开发报表生成工具时,通过WPS.Style.setFont()设置标题字体为加粗16号,再通过WPS.Range.setBorder()为数据区域添加边框。

3. 数据处理与计算
针对Excel文件,WPSSDK内置了公式计算引擎,支持SUM、AVERAGE等常用函数,也可通过WPS.Formula.calculate()执行自定义公式。开发者可以构建财务分析工具,自动计算利润表中的各项指标,并将结果动态填充到指定单元格。

4. 图表与可视化
工具包允许在文档中插入图表(柱状图、折线图、饼图等),并自定义图表数据源和样式。例如,在销售数据分析应用中,调用WPS.Chart.add()创建柱状图,再通过WPS.Chart.setData()绑定月度销售额数据,最后用WPS.Chart.setColor()设置不同系列的颜色。

5. 文档协作与共享
WPSSDK集成了WPS的协作功能,支持多人实时编辑和版本控制。开发者可通过WPS.Collaboration.enable()开启协作模式,用户能在应用内直接邀请他人编辑文档,并通过WPS.Version.list()获取历史版本列表,方便回滚或对比修改。

6. 安全与权限管理
工具包提供了文档加密、权限设置接口,可限制打印、复制或编辑权限。例如,使用WPS.Security.setPassword()为文档设置打开密码,再通过WPS.Permission.setEdit(false)禁止普通用户修改内容,适合开发内部资料管理系统。

7. 跨平台兼容性
WPSSDK支持Windows、macOS、Linux等多平台,开发者编写的代码无需修改即可在不同系统运行。同时,它兼容WPS Office的各个版本,确保功能稳定性。

8. 插件与扩展开发
开发者可通过WPSSDK创建自定义插件,扩展WPS的功能。例如,开发一个“邮件合并”插件,调用WPS.Plugin.register()注册插件后,用户可在WPS菜单中直接调用,将Excel数据批量填充到Word模板并生成多份邮件。

9. 自动化与脚本支持
工具包支持VBA脚本兼容,开发者可录制或编写脚本自动化重复操作。例如,用WPS.Script.run()执行一段脚本,自动将所有表格中的负数标记为红色。

10. 调试与日志工具
WPSSDK内置了调试接口,如WPS.Debug.log()可输出操作日志,帮助开发者快速定位问题。同时,提供错误码和描述,方便排查接口调用失败的原因。

使用场景示例
假设需要开发一个“自动生成周报”的工具,步骤如下:
1. 调用WPS.Document.create()新建Word文档;
2. 用WPS.Range.insertText()添加标题和日期;
3. 通过WPS.Table.add()插入表格,并用WPS.Range.setValue()填充数据;
4. 使用WPS.Chart.add()生成销售趋势图;
5. 最后调用WPS.Document.save()保存到指定路径。

WPSSDK通过模块化设计,降低了集成WPS功能的难度,即使没有深厚开发经验的用户,也能通过查阅官方文档和示例代码快速上手。无论是企业办公系统、教育平台还是个人工具开发,它都能提供高效的技术支持。

WPSSDK工具包如何安装使用?

想要安装和使用WPSSDK工具包,其实非常简单,只需要按照以下步骤操作,即使是初次接触的小白也能轻松上手。

第一步:下载WPSSDK工具包
首先,你需要找到WPSSDK工具包的官方下载渠道。通常,开发者会在其官网或者GitHub等代码托管平台上提供最新版本的下载链接。找到适合你操作系统的版本(Windows、macOS或Linux),点击下载按钮,将工具包保存到你的电脑上。

第二步:解压工具包
下载完成后,你会得到一个压缩文件(比如.zip或.tar.gz格式)。使用系统自带的解压工具或者第三方解压软件(如WinRAR、7-Zip等),将压缩文件解压到一个你容易找到的文件夹中。解压后,你会看到里面包含了一些文件和文件夹,这些都是WPSSDK工具包的核心内容。

第三步:配置环境变量(可选但推荐)
为了让系统能够全局识别WPSSDK工具包中的命令,你可以选择将其安装路径添加到系统的环境变量中。这一步对于Windows用户来说,可以通过“此电脑”右键选择“属性”,然后进入“高级系统设置”->“环境变量”,在“系统变量”中找到“Path”变量,点击编辑,将WPSSDK的安装路径添加进去。对于macOS和Linux用户,通常需要在.bashrc或.zshrc等配置文件中添加PATH变量。

第四步:验证安装
打开命令行工具(Windows的CMD或PowerShell,macOS和Linux的Terminal),输入WPSSDK的版本查询命令(通常是wpssdk --version或类似的命令,具体可以参考工具包的文档)。如果命令行返回了WPSSDK的版本信息,说明你已经成功安装了WPSSDK工具包。

第五步:开始使用
现在,你可以开始使用WPSSDK工具包了。根据你需要实现的功能,查阅WPSSDK的官方文档或者教程,了解具体的命令和参数。比如,如果你想使用WPSSDK进行文件处理,就可以在命令行中输入相应的文件处理命令,然后按照提示操作即可。

在使用过程中,如果遇到任何问题,不要害怕,可以查阅WPSSDK的官方文档、社区论坛或者搜索相关的教程和解答。随着使用的深入,你会逐渐熟悉WPSSDK的各种功能和命令,成为使用WPSSDK的行家。

WPSSDK工具包支持哪些系统?

WPSSDK工具包是一款针对WPS办公软件进行二次开发的工具包,它为开发者提供了丰富的API接口和功能模块,方便快速集成WPS的核心功能到自己的应用中。关于WPSSDK工具包支持的系统,这里为你详细说明。

WPSSDK工具包主要支持Windows系统,这是其最核心的兼容平台。无论是32位还是64位的Windows操作系统,WPSSDK工具包都能很好地适配。例如,Windows 7、Windows 8、Windows 10以及Windows 11等版本,都可以使用WPSSDK工具包进行开发。如果你是在Windows系统下进行开发,可以放心地选择WPSSDK工具包,它能为你提供稳定且强大的功能支持。

除了Windows系统外,WPSSDK工具包目前并没有明确官方支持其他操作系统,比如macOS或Linux。这主要是因为WPS办公软件本身在这些系统上的版本和功能实现与Windows有所不同,因此WPSSDK工具包在跨平台兼容性上有所限制。如果你需要在这些系统上进行开发,可能需要考虑其他替代方案或者与WPS官方进行沟通,看是否有特定的解决方案。

不过,值得注意的是,随着技术的不断发展和WPS办公软件的更新迭代,WPSSDK工具包未来可能会增加对其他操作系统的支持。因此,如果你有跨平台开发的需求,可以持续关注WPS的官方动态,以便及时获取最新的开发工具和资源。

WPSSDK工具包有哪些功能和使用优势?

总的来说,如果你是在Windows系统下进行WPS办公软件的二次开发,WPSSDK工具包是一个非常不错的选择。它提供了丰富的功能接口和稳定的性能支持,能帮助你快速实现自己的开发需求。

WPSSDK工具包收费标准是怎样的?

WPSSDK工具包是一款为开发者提供便捷WPS办公功能集成的开发工具,其收费标准会因版本、功能模块以及使用场景的不同而有所差异。以下为你详细介绍其收费相关内容:

基础免费版

WPSSDK工具包通常会有一个基础免费版本。这个版本主要面向个人开发者或者小型项目,提供一些基本的功能,例如文档的简单创建、读取和基础编辑操作。对于一些对功能需求不高,只是想初步体验WPSSDK工具包或者进行简单开发的用户来说,基础免费版是一个不错的选择。它可以帮助开发者快速上手,了解工具包的基本使用方式,而无需支付任何费用。不过,免费版可能会在功能上有所限制,比如不支持高级的格式设置、无法使用一些特殊的插件功能等。

专业付费版

如果开发者需要更强大的功能,那么专业付费版会是更好的选择。专业付费版的收费标准会根据不同的功能套餐来定。 - 功能套餐分类:一般会有多个功能套餐可供选择,比如标准套餐、高级套餐和企业定制套餐。标准套餐可能包含了常见的文档处理功能,如复杂的表格操作、图表插入与编辑、文档的批量处理等,价格相对较为亲民,适合中小型企业的常规办公开发需求。高级套餐则在标准套餐的基础上,增加了更多高级功能,如与第三方系统的深度集成、数据安全加密的更高级别设置、多用户协作的更精细管理等,价格会相对高一些,主要面向对功能要求较高、有一定规模的企业。企业定制套餐则是根据企业的具体需求进行定制开发,收费会根据定制的功能复杂程度、开发工作量等因素来确定,这种套餐适合大型企业或者有特殊业务需求的企业。 - 收费模式:专业付费版的收费模式通常有按年订阅和一次性买断两种。按年订阅的方式可以让企业每年根据自身的发展情况调整是否继续使用,费用相对较低,但长期使用下来总费用可能会较高。一次性买断的方式则适合那些确定会长期使用WPSSDK工具包的企业,虽然一次性支付的费用较高,但从长远来看,可以节省成本。

特殊场景收费

在一些特殊的使用场景下,WPSSDK工具包可能会有额外的收费。例如,如果企业需要将工具包部署在多个服务器上,或者需要为大量的用户提供服务,那么可能会根据服务器数量或者用户数量收取额外的费用。此外,如果企业需要WPSSDK工具包提供技术支持和售后服务,也可能会根据服务的级别和时长收取一定的费用。

获取准确收费信息的方式

由于WPSSDK工具包的收费标准可能会随着市场情况和产品更新而发生变化,为了获取最准确的收费信息,建议你直接联系WPSSDK工具包的官方客服。你可以通过官方网站上的联系方式,如在线客服、客服邮箱或者客服电话,与客服人员沟通你的具体需求,他们会为你提供详细的收费方案和报价。同时,你也可以关注WPSSDK工具包的官方社交媒体账号或者订阅其官方邮件列表,及时获取产品的最新动态和优惠活动信息。

总之,WPSSDK工具包的收费标准是多样化的,你可以根据自己的实际需求和预算选择适合的版本和套餐。

WPSSDK工具包更新日志在哪里查看?

想要查看WPSSDK工具包的更新日志,可以通过以下几种方式来获取详细信息,尤其适合不太熟悉技术文档查找的小白用户,每一步都尽量详细说明:

1. 访问官方网站
WPSSDK工具包通常会有一个官方网站,比如WPS Office的开发者平台或者相关SDK的专属页面。进入官网后,寻找“文档”“下载”或者“更新日志”这类明显的入口。很多官网会把更新日志单独列出来,方便开发者快速查看新版本的变化。如果官网结构比较复杂,可以尝试使用网站的搜索功能,输入“WPSSDK 更新日志”这样的关键词,通常能快速定位到相关页面。

2. 查阅GitHub仓库(如果开源)
如果WPSSDK是开源项目,并且托管在GitHub上,那么更新日志一般会在项目的仓库中明确展示。进入GitHub后,搜索WPSSDK的仓库名称。进入仓库主页后,找到“Releases”这个标签页,这里会列出所有版本的发布信息,包括每个版本的更新内容、修复的问题以及新增的功能。这种方式适合喜欢直接查看代码和版本记录的技术用户。

3. 查看文档中心或开发者指南
很多SDK工具包会配套提供详细的文档中心,里面不仅有API使用说明,还会有更新日志的部分。可以尝试在搜索引擎中输入“WPSSDK 文档中心”或者“WPSSDK 开发者指南”,找到对应的文档页面后,在目录中查找“更新日志”或者“版本历史”这样的章节。这种方式适合希望系统学习SDK所有功能的用户。

4. 订阅邮件列表或社区通知
有些SDK团队会通过邮件列表或者社区论坛来发布更新通知。如果你已经注册了WPSSDK的相关账号,或者加入了它们的开发者社区,可以检查一下邮箱或者社区公告板,看看是否有最新的更新日志推送。这种方式适合希望第一时间获取更新信息的活跃用户。

5. 直接联系技术支持
如果以上方法都没有找到需要的更新日志,还可以尝试直接联系WPSSDK的技术支持团队。很多SDK的官网或者文档中都会提供技术支持的联系方式,比如邮箱、在线客服或者论坛。向他们说明你的需求,通常能得到快速且准确的回复。这种方式适合遇到特殊问题或者需要个性化帮助的用户。

通过以上几种方式,应该能够轻松找到WPSSDK工具包的更新日志。每种方式都有其适用场景,可以根据自己的需求和习惯选择最适合的一种。希望这些详细的步骤能帮助你快速解决问题!

WPSSDK工具包和同类工具相比有什么优势?

WPSSDK工具包是一款专为WPS办公软件生态设计的开发工具包,相比其他同类工具,它在功能集成、兼容性、开发效率及生态支持等方面展现出显著优势。以下从多个维度详细解析其核心优势,帮助开发者更直观地理解其价值。

一、深度集成WPS生态,功能覆盖更全面

WPSSDK工具包与WPS办公软件深度绑定,支持直接调用WPS的文档处理、表格计算、演示制作等核心功能。例如,开发者可通过SDK实现文档的批量处理、格式转换、模板定制等操作,而这些功能在同类工具中可能需要依赖多个独立API或插件完成。此外,WPSSDK提供了对WPS特有功能的支持,如云文档协作、多端同步等,这是其他工具难以复制的生态优势。

二、跨平台兼容性强,开发成本更低

WPSSDK支持Windows、macOS、Linux等多操作系统,且与WPS移动端(Android/iOS)无缝对接。相比部分同类工具仅支持单一平台或需要额外适配,WPSSDK的跨平台特性大幅降低了开发者的适配成本。例如,开发者可基于同一套代码实现桌面端与移动端的功能同步,无需为不同平台单独开发,节省了50%以上的开发时间。

三、开发效率高,API设计更友好

WPSSDK的API接口设计遵循简洁、直观的原则,提供了丰富的开发文档和示例代码。即使是初学者,也能快速上手实现基础功能。例如,通过几行代码即可完成文档的创建、编辑和保存操作,而同类工具可能需要更复杂的参数配置。此外,WPSSDK支持热更新功能,开发者可在不重启应用的情况下动态加载新功能,进一步提升了开发迭代效率。

四、安全性能突出,符合企业级需求

WPSSDK内置了WPS的安全防护机制,支持文档加密、权限控制、操作审计等功能。这对于企业用户尤为重要,可有效防止数据泄露和非法操作。相比之下,部分同类工具在安全功能上较为薄弱,或需要额外付费购买安全模块。WPSSDK的安全性能已通过多项行业认证,能满足金融、政府等高安全要求场景的需求。

五、社区支持完善,问题解决更高效

WPSSDK拥有活跃的开发者社区和官方技术支持团队。开发者在遇到问题时,可通过社区论坛、在线文档或直接联系技术支持获取帮助。官方团队会定期更新SDK版本,修复漏洞并新增功能,确保开发者始终使用最新、最稳定的工具。而部分同类工具的社区支持较弱,问题反馈周期较长,可能影响开发进度。

六、成本效益高,免费与付费版本灵活选择

WPSSDK提供了免费基础版和付费企业版两种选择。免费版已包含大部分核心功能,适合个人开发者或小型团队使用;企业版则提供了更高级的功能,如批量授权、定制化开发等,且价格相比同类工具更具竞争力。这种灵活的定价策略,让不同规模的开发者都能找到适合自己的方案。

总结

WPSSDK工具包凭借其深度生态集成、跨平台兼容性、高效开发体验、安全性能、社区支持及成本优势,成为WPS生态下开发者不可忽视的选择。无论是快速实现基础功能,还是构建复杂的企业级应用,WPSSDK都能提供稳定、高效的解决方案。对于希望降低开发成本、提升效率的开发者来说,WPSSDK无疑是更优的选择。

热门

        Copyright © Some Rights Reserved.